Limit Break

6* is the highest grade a character can attain which sets his/her level cap to 50. This can be further increased up to LV60 by feeding other 6* characters to the character you want to limit break. Each limit break only increases the level cap by 2 levels so you’ll have to go through 5 limit breaks for a character to reach LV60. After limit breaking, you also need to max out the character’s level again before you can break the level cap once again. Here are the necessary 6* fodder characters needed per level:

50-52: 6* x1

52-54: 6* x1

54-56: 6* x2

56-58: 6* x2

58-60: 6* x3

Limit break doesn’t only increase the character’s stats but also allows them to unlock a new talent every 2 levels. At LV60, you’ll be able to unlock the character’s second passive skill. These passive Skills are very powerful and unique to the character, making them even more potent and effective.

There’s no limitation about what heroes that can be used as fodder in limit breaks as long as it’s 6*. As such, be careful not to accidentally feed 6* SSR heroes, advent heroes, and enhancemons. SSR heroes should be used for enhancing their original’s Skills while advent heroes and enhancemons should be exclusively used only for enhancing a hero’s stats. You should be primarily using evolvemons and sometimes unwanted Rs and SR characters when limit breaking.
